  • Patent number: 12193819
    Abstract: An arousal level control apparatus calculates a setting value of a control device under a constraint condition using an arousal level optimization model so that a value of an objective function is maximized. The control device affects a physical quantity of a surrounding environment that affects arousal level of a subject. The arousal level optimization model includes the constraint condition and the objective function. The constraint condition includes a physical quantity prediction model, an arousal level prediction model, and a setting value range condition that the setting value is within a predetermined range. The physical quantity prediction model is an explicit function that includes the physical quantity and the setting value as explanatory variables and has a predicted value of the physical quantity as an explained variable.

  • Publication number: 20250013711
    Abstract: The input means 81 accepts input of a condition to be satisfied by a parameter. The model generation means 82 converts the input condition into a model represented by a Hamiltonian. The annealing process means 83 generates an Ising model from the converted model and inputs the generated Ising model to an annealing machine to perform annealing. The output means 84 converts an annealing result into the parameter and outputs the parameter.
